Regarding a 96 lot subdivision on 58.8 acres along the treeline on the
West side of a wetland park called North Creek at the end of 9th. I
strongly encourage you to re-think this project. Our natural areas that
sustain rapidly disappearing wildlife are being gobbled up by rampant
development and to intrude on such a rich park area in favor of this new
subdivision is short-sighted and disastrous for the bird populations in
the area.

There is a heron rookery that is adjacent to the new subdivision. It's
the treeline directly behind it that's at risk, and the fear is that the
encroachment as well as short term construction disruption will be the
factor that drives them out. Their trees, apparently, will remain.

The re-tailed hawk habitat, any forest bird habitat (including a
Pileated Woodpecker - WDFW State Species of Concern), the trees
themselves are all at great risk of disappearing very soon due to new
subdivision along a public park.
